Abstract

This paper deals with measuring small mechanical oscillations or vibrations. It is briefly shown that the use of conventional methods is often not possible because of the influence of measuring instruments on the system's parameters. The second obstacle is absence of room to place the instrument or its elements. This paper describes a new approach in measuring by use of a laser beam which permits one to obtain stable results with an accuracy range up to 10 mu m. An example of the application of the described method for measuring relay contact and for the needle holder of the sewing machine vibrations is given.
